CC   -!- FUNCTION: In eubacteria ppGpp (guanosine 3'-diphosphate 5'-diphosphate)
CC       is a mediator of the stringent response that coordinates a variety of
CC       cellular activities in response to changes in nutritional abundance.
CC       {ECO:0000256|RuleBase:RU003847}.
CC   -!- SIMILARITY: Belongs to the relA/spoT family.
